Cessna 525B Citation CJ3 (525B / CJ3)

Overview

2008 Cessna 525B (Citation CJ3), MSN 525B0276. Registered to Lucky Stars LLC, Missoula MT. Airworthiness certificate dated 2008-10-08; certificate issue / registration activity in 2021 with a later registry action in 2024.

Specifications

  • Engines: 2× Williams FJ44-3A (2820 lbf each)
  • Range: 2040 nm
  • Cruise: 416 kts
  • Seats: 8
  • Ceiling: 45000 ft

The Cessna 525B Citation CJ3 occupies a performance niche as a light, twin-engine business jet offering transregional range and higher cruise speeds, exemplified by this airframe’s 416 kts cruise and 45,000 ft ceiling. In market terms, the CJ3 competes with other light-cabin jets for private owners and charter operators who prioritize efficient regional travel; the supplied value of $3,895,000 positions this specific airframe within the pre-owned light-jet segment. Resale and maintenance considerations for this model typically emphasize engine life, avionics condition—here the Collins Pro Line 21 fit—and logbook continuity; specific service history for N765JP was not provided.
